The transition from centralized to decentralized, user-centric identity models addresses the glaring privacy and security issues of traditional systems. These systems are prone to data breaches and surveillance, driving the need for innovative solutions. Blockchain technology, with its transparency and immutability, offers a robust foundation for these new models. On-chain data, stored directly on the blockchain, ensures transparency and immutability, making it ideal for secure identity verification. Off-chain data, stored outside the blockchain, provides the detailed context needed for real-world applications but is susceptible to manipulation. The challenge lies in securely integrating these two types of data to create a seamless and secure identity ecosystem.

The industry is also seeing a surge in blockchain-based protocols dedicated to decentralized identity solutions. Humanity Protocol, emerging from stealth mode in February 2024 with a $30M raise at a $1B valuation, focuses on biometric-backed decentralized identity verification. By linking palm scans to digital identities on-chain, Humanity Protocol aims to combat bots and enhance privacy. VANA, on the other hand, empowers users with self-sovereign identities (SSI), allowing them to control their personal data. SSI is an open standard that uses digital wallets to store credentials securely, giving individuals maximum control over their data.

Experts like Mehran Shakeri from the SAP Innovation Center Network emphasize the importance of SSI, stating, “SSI is a completely open standard that gives individuals maximum control over their data.” Alexander Schaefer from the SAP Innovation Center California sees potential in integrating SSI into business networks and supply chain transparency, showcasing its versatility.

However, the journey towards a secure digital identity is fraught with challenges. The need for widespread adoption of SSI, the risks associated with biometric data, and the potential for manipulation of off-chain data all pose significant hurdles. Critics argue that reliance on biometric data could lead to privacy concerns if not properly managed.
